Can you get cash advance from PayPal Credit?

PayPal Credit is a popular payment method for online purchases, offering customers the flexibility to pay for their items over time. But what about getting a cash advance from PayPal Credit? Can you access cash in a pinch using this payment option? Let’s dive into this question and explore the possibilities.

If you find yourself in need of quick cash, PayPal Credit is not the best option. Unlike credit cards or traditional loans, PayPal Credit does not offer a cash advance feature. This means that you cannot withdraw cash directly from your PayPal Credit account to use as physical currency. Additionally, PayPal Credit is intended for purchases through PayPal merchants, so it is not designed to function as a cash advance service.

However, there are still ways to access cash using PayPal. One option is to link your PayPal account to a debit card or bank account. This will allow you to transfer funds from your PayPal account to your connected bank account, where you can then withdraw cash from an ATM. Keep in mind that there may be fees associated with this type of transfer, so be sure to check with PayPal for any applicable charges.
